- Please note that the angle of this shield is based on the LT and will be slightly different than the stock angle on an RT windshield
Vent – there are two options:
- Standard position vent is 6 1/4″ from bottom of shield to bottom of the vent
- High position vent is 10 3/4″ from bottom of shield to bottom of vent (if additional instruments have been added to the inner dashboard)
Measurement Location:
- Length is measured in the center of the shield from top to bottom
- The angle of our replacement is 47 degrees when mounted on the bike

Paul –
My Clearview windshield arrived on Friday. On my ‘87 K100RT, it has eliminated most wind noise below 60 mph and significantly reduced the buffeting noise between 60-80 mph. It protects my arms from the cold, piercing wind and it does not cause a back draft or pressure on my back. As well, it does not flex in the wind as did the stock windshield. As an added bonus, for the first time I can see the road directly in front of me through the windshield. The stock windshield did not allow this view. I was concerned that the tint might be too dark, but no, it is just enough to reduce the glare. As with the stock,I am able to see over the windshield for a clear unobstructed view of the road.

Steve –
I received the shield two days ago, installed it and took the bike for a test ride, and I want to tell you that I am very happy with the product. The fit and finish are great, and the modifications I asked for (non-standard location of the vent and reduction of the shield height) are spot on. I now have a true see-over windshield on my BMW K100, with better aerodynamics than the stock shield and a vent that directs airflow where I want it, or can be closed off on chilly mornings. I had previously tried a Parabellum aftermarket shield and returned it, unsatisfied. Your shields are clearly better than Parabellum’s, in my opinion.
